How often do I need to renew my Missouri medical marijuana card?
Missouri medical marijuana certificates are valid for three years and can be renewed online.
A renewal consultation with Leafwell costs $99, and you'll only be charged if approved. Plus, when you renew with Leafwell, we'll send you a reminder 30 days before your certification expires to make sure you have plenty of time to submit your renewal application with the state.
Here's a summary of the renewal process:
- Sign in to Leafwell, or if you’re new to Leafwell, register as a renewal patient here.
- Speak to a Missouri-licensed healthcare provider online.
- Once approved, the provider will submit your certification directly to the state.
- Log into the Missouri Medical Marijuana Program to complete the state renewal application and pay the $26.50 state fee.
- After submitting your application, you will receive a confirmation email from the state with an application reference code/application ID number.
- Once approved, immediately download your new card from your registry portal.
